okay, I finally got DW after waiting a while for the price to drop a little(it never did:-? ), and I've got a couple of questions I haven't seen answered yet.
1. Is there any way to reverse the vertical mouse axis for the 3D view? 2. Is there any way to switch between platforms during a mission? So If I'm in the ship, and launch the Helo, can I switch to the helo? 3. how can you tell when a wire guided torp has a solid lock on a target? Sometimes, it seems like it should lock to me, but when I engage it, it goes into it's search pattern even though the target is directly between the red lines. 4. If I'm running at 1280x1024, why does everything look great except the sky seems to have this low resolution smog in it(Nvidia 6600GT)? Is there any way to get rid of this? 5. Where can I find how much fuel/battery is left? Is it possible to run out of fuel? that's it for now, thanks :) |

What you observe is called dithering and it happens on ATI cards also. It becomes worse if you enable AA and AF since the game doesn't support them. There is no way to eliminate "the low resolution smog". |

I recommend playing a lot of time using show truth when you are first learning the game. It will help you understand how your sensor data relates to what is actually happening and how various objects interact with the DW environment and what this looks like on your sensors. Quote:
The MH60 has two hours of fuel I believe. Yes, you can runout but there is no meter, unfortunately. To reload ammo and fuel, you can land on any friendly platform and you'll be restocked. Where can I find how much fuel/battery is left? Is it possible to run out of fuel? The frigate will never run out of fuel to be honest unless your sitting at your computer for a month you probably wont run out of fuel infact it doesnt have a fuel setting because the missions are considerd short some of the longest missions you may do will take a few hours and you realy are not going to use a full tank in that time even at flank all the way. The kilo can run out of battery you will find this on the ship control panel near where it says port and starbord engines its a dial with a percentage meter on it, if your very careful you can definatly get 24 to 36 hours out of your battery but if your reckless you will be surfacing within the hour, only to find that my akula is on your tail.
